Shadows screams again! IMHO, this song is sort of like an angry shout at the heavens.
"You wanna hear my side?
You need to drown to know."
This is like them saying God wouldn't know what death, sorrow and loss feel like, since he himself isn't human.
On the other hand, this song is also speaking to us, humans, about WHY God came to hate us even though he created us - like it's our own fault we were cast out of paradise.
"You better take your time
(LIE RAPE KILL)
You better take it slow
Cause when you see the one
(LOVE HATE FEAR)
Theres nothing left to show."
"the one" here probably refers to God - and when you meet him, you'll have to face up to all the shit you've done wrong in your life and for the evil of humanity in general.
